Why does my blood pressure rise in heat?

Summer weather can affect blood pressure because the body tries to dissipate heat. High temperature and high humidity cause more blood flow to the skin. This causes the heart to beat faster while circulating twice as much blood per minute as on a normal day.

What time of day is blood pressure highest?

Usually, blood pressure starts to rise a few hours before you wake up.Continue to rise during the day, reaching a peak noon. Blood pressure usually drops in the late afternoon and evening. Blood pressure is usually lower at night when you go to bed.

Is 150 90 good blood pressure?

High blood pressure is considered to be 140/90mmHg or higher (150/90mmHg or higher if you are over 80) Ideal blood pressure is usually considered to be Between 90/60mmHg and 120/80 mmHg.

Does the sun lower blood pressure?

Recent research has shown that Spending more time outdoors in the sun can lower your low pressureThe study found that nitric oxide stored in the surface layer of the skin reacts to sunlight and causes blood vessels to widen as the oxide enters the bloodstream. This in turn lowers blood pressure.

Can lack of sleep cause high blood pressure?

Insomnia Linked to high blood pressure and heart disease. Over time, lack of sleep can also lead to unhealthy habits that can damage your heart, including higher stress levels, less motivation for physical activity, and unhealthy food choices.

Why is my blood pressure suddenly high?

Some possible causes include caffeine, acute stress or anxietycertain medications (such as NSAIDs), drug combinations, recreational medications, sudden or acute pain, dehydration, and white coat effect (fear of being in the hospital or doctor’s office).

What is stroke level blood pressure?

blood pressure reading above 180/120 mmHg Considered stroke level, the risk is high and requires immediate medical attention.

Is BP 140/90 too high?

Normal pressure is 120/80 or lower. If it reads 130/80, your blood pressure is considered high (stage 1). stage 2 hypertension 140/90 or higher. Seek immediate medical attention if you get multiple blood pressure readings of 180/110 or higher.

What blood pressure should I go to the hospital for?

If your blood pressure reading is 180/120 or higher And you have any of the following symptoms, which may be signs of organ damage: Chest pain. Shortness of breath.
